MPs voice new nuclear arms race fears
Concerns have been raised by MPs about the looming collapse of a nuclear treaty between the United States and Russia which has endured for thirty years. Washington has announced it will pulling out of the Intermediate-Range Nuclear Forces Treaty. The following day Moscow said it would follow suit. Chris Wimpress reports.
